Findings and Conclusions:
A complaint was received by the Director General of the Workplace Relations commission by the complainant alleging breaches of the statutes identified above. The said complaint was referred to me for investigation. A hearing for that purpose was held on November 2nd, 2018. There was no appearance by or on behalf of the complainant at the hearing. I am satisfied that the said complainant was informed in writing of the date, time and place at which the hearing to investigate the complaint would be held. She had previously engaged with the WRC in relation to her complaint. In these circumstances and in the absence of any evidence to the contrary having been adduced before me, I must conclude that the within complaint is not well-founded and I decide accordingly. |
Decision:
Section 41 of the Workplace Relations Act 2015 requires that I make a decision in relation to the complaints in accordance with the relevant redress provisions under Schedule 6 of that Act.
For the reasons set out above I do not uphold complaints CA-00019549-009, 011 and 012 and they are dismissed. |
